What's Eating You Podcast with Clinical Psychologist Stephanie Georgiou - Eating disorders NO ONE TALKS ABOUT! Type 1 diabetes and Diabulimia | Ep 193

Eating disorders NO ONE TALKS ABOUT! Type 1 diabetes and Diabulimia | Ep 193

What's Eating You Podcast with Clinical Psychologist Stephanie Georgiou

play

08/25/24 • 22 min

Would you put your health at risk to lose weight? What if you lost 10 kgs but it meant also losing your eyesight, kidney failure or a coma?

Today's episode is going to take a deep dive into type 1 diabetes and the comorbidity with eating disorders.The fact that eating disorders are more prevalent in young women with type 1 diabetes has been well documented (Affenito et al, 1997; Rodin et al, 1986; Rydall et al, 1997; Pinar, 2005).

The omission of insulin in order to promote weight loss is much less understood and researched,sugar goes high - ketoacidosis - burns your fat instead. Type 1 diabetics need to inject insulin to control their blood sugar and burns carbs

What's Eating You Podcast with Clinical Psychologist Stephanie Georgiou - Achieving Financial Freedom with ADHD Accountant Tina Mathams!| Ep 209

Achieving Financial Freedom with ADHD Accountant Tina Mathams!| Ep 209

What's Eating You Podcast with Clinical Psychologist Stephanie Georgiou

play

10/01/24 • 49 min

If you've ever felt like your finances are a mess, you are not alone, especially if you're living with ADHD. Research shows that people with ADHD are up to three times more likely to have financial problems, including debt, impulsive spending, and difficulty managing money. If you're struggling to budget, if you spend impulsively and you have buyer's remorse, this episode is for you.

What's Eating You Podcast with Clinical Psychologist Stephanie Georgiou - Does ADHD Presents Differently In Women Compared To Men? Part 1 | Ep 219

Does ADHD Presents Differently In Women Compared To Men? Part 1 | Ep 219

What's Eating You Podcast with Clinical Psychologist Stephanie Georgiou

play

11/17/24 • 18 min

Did you know ADHD is diagnosed three times more in men than it is in women? Not only that, Women are diagnosed with ADHD on average 5 years later than boys, aged around 12, instead of 7.

This episode covers:

ADHD in girls and how it presents differently than in boys

How undiagnosed ADHD affects women's mental health and confidence

Common struggle for women with ADHD.
